新聞中心
在jQuery中,清空元素的方法有很多種,以下是一些常見的方法:

創(chuàng)新互聯(lián)專業(yè)為企業(yè)提供南豐網(wǎng)站建設(shè)、南豐做網(wǎng)站、南豐網(wǎng)站設(shè)計(jì)、南豐網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計(jì)與制作、南豐企業(yè)網(wǎng)站模板建站服務(wù),十余年南豐做網(wǎng)站經(jīng)驗(yàn),不只是建網(wǎng)站,更提供有價(jià)值的思路和整體網(wǎng)絡(luò)服務(wù)。
1、使用empty()方法
empty()方法是jQuery中最常用的清空元素的方法,它可以移除元素的所有子節(jié)點(diǎn)和文本內(nèi)容,但不會(huì)刪除元素本身,示例代碼如下:
$("#elementId").empty();
2、使用html()方法
html()方法可以獲取或設(shè)置元素的HTML內(nèi)容,當(dāng)我們將一個(gè)空字符串傳遞給它時(shí),它會(huì)清空元素的內(nèi)容,示例代碼如下:
$("#elementId").html("");
3、使用remove()方法
remove()方法可以刪除元素及其所有子節(jié)點(diǎn)和文本內(nèi)容,示例代碼如下:
$("#elementId").remove();
4、使用detach()方法
detach()方法可以分離元素,即從文檔中刪除元素,但仍保持其在DOM中的引用,示例代碼如下:
$("#elementId").detach();
5、使用replaceWith()方法
replaceWith()方法可以用指定的HTML或DOM元素替換當(dāng)前元素,如果我們傳遞一個(gè)空的jQuery對(duì)象,它將清空當(dāng)前元素,示例代碼如下:
$("#elementId").replaceWith($(""));
6、使用clear()方法
clear()方法是jQuery UI庫中的一個(gè)方法,用于清除與選擇器匹配的元素的內(nèi)容,示例代碼如下:
$("#elementId").clear();
7、使用val()方法(針對(duì)表單元素)
對(duì)于表單元素,如輸入框、文本區(qū)域等,我們可以使用val()方法來清空其內(nèi)容,示例代碼如下:
$("#elementId").val("");
8、使用text()方法(針對(duì)文本元素)
對(duì)于文本元素,如 9、使用CSS樣式清空元素內(nèi)容(不推薦) 雖然可以通過設(shè)置元素的CSS樣式來達(dá)到清空元素內(nèi)容的目的,但這并不是一種推薦的做法,因?yàn)樗赡軙?huì)影響其他依賴于元素內(nèi)容的腳本,示例代碼如下: 10、使用JavaScript原生方法清空元素內(nèi)容(不推薦) 同樣,我們也可以通過JavaScript原生方法來清空元素內(nèi)容,但這也不是一種推薦的做法,因?yàn)樗赡軙?huì)影響其他依賴于元素內(nèi)容的腳本,示例代碼如下: 在jQuery中,有多種方法可以清空元素的內(nèi)容,根據(jù)具體的需求和場(chǎng)景,我們可以選擇最合適的方法來實(shí)現(xiàn)清空操作,需要注意的是,雖然通過設(shè)置元素的CSS樣式或JavaScript原生方法可以達(dá)到清空元素內(nèi)容的目的,但這并不是一種推薦的做法,因?yàn)樗赡軙?huì)影響其他依賴于元素內(nèi)容的腳本,在實(shí)際開發(fā)中,我們應(yīng)盡量使用jQuery提供的專門用于清空元素內(nèi)容的方法。、text()方法來清空其內(nèi)容,示例代碼如下:
$("#elementId").text("");
$("#elementId").css({"height": "0", "overflow": "hidden"});
$("#elementId")[0].innerHTML = "";
當(dāng)前文章:jquery清空子元素
文章鏈接:http://m.fisionsoft.com.cn/article/dpcgghi.html


咨詢
建站咨詢
